Transaction 15f36aef3141411989cb98f8ad0747fd06c8174005cb9601588a57c738415e00
1 Input
1 Output
-
15f36aef3141411989cb98f8ad0747fd06c8174005cb9601588a57c738415e00:0
- value
- 19628647
- script pubkey
- OP_0 OP_PUSHBYTES_20 975a1a915dd08e9ed6dfda9d3d04c9fce51e5f66
- address
- bc1qjadp4y2a6z8fa4klm2wn6pxflnj3uhmx76jq8y